Located in Spokane County, Washington, Cheney is a community with a population of 12,830. Its median household income of $47,039 runs below the Spokane County figure of $73,513.
From 2019 to 2023, Cheney's population grew 5.5% from 12,165 to 12,830, while its median home value rose 62.3% from $203,500 to $330,300.
37.7% of homes are single-family detached houses. The typical home was built around 1989.

| Year | Population | Median household income | Median home value | Median gross rent |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2019 | 12,165 | $40,573 | $203,500 | $893 |
| 2020 | 12,455 | $43,567 | $225,900 | $954 |
| 2021 | 12,743 | $42,275 | $239,500 | $956 |
| 2022 | 12,848 | $45,419 | $291,900 | $1,020 |
| 2023 | 12,830 | $47,039 | $330,300 | $1,075 |
Each year is a US Census Bureau ACS 5-year estimate ending that year.
